Keys in various types

There are a variety of keys on the market, each offering the perfect balance of convenience and protection. For example Cylinder keys are widely employed in both residential and commercial settings. Mortice keys are, however are more secure and are commonly found in traditional structures. Tubular keys also have a cylindrical shaft that can be fitted into the tubular pin tumbler lock, typically used to secure sheds and bikes.

In addition to a range of cutting methods, modern keys can also be programmed to be compatible with specific vehicle systems. This is typically carried out at the dealership or by a licensed locksmith who has access proper equipment for programming keys.

For example, some of the most well-known modern car keys are designed like remotes, and are not required to be turned to start the vehicle. These keys are known as smart keys. They have a microchip inside them that is coded to the specific make and model of car it will use. These keys can be programmed and cut at the hands of a locksmith who is also a member of the Associated Locksmiths of America (ALOA).

It is always advisable to have a spare car key, especially if you live in an area with high crime rates. This is because car theft has become a common and relatively easy criminal enterprise. If you do lose the keys to your car, it is important to have them duplicated quickly so that you can get back on the road and not spend time trying to find your vehicle.

While a standard key can be cut by a standard machine, more complex keys require special tools and a trained technician to accurately duplicate them. Keys cut with lasers for instance, have patterns that consist of long valleys rather than the ridges common to older keys. They are also more difficult to duplicate because of their complicated shape.

Another type of key that requires a professional to cut is the transponder key. These keys are commonly found in newer cars and can only by duplicated by a locksmith using the appropriate equipment for programming. They are equipped with a microchip that must be programmed into the vehicle to enable it to start.

Tools Used

You'll need several tools to cut keys professionally. This includes the key duplication machine that cuts and duplicates regular keys as well as automotive keys. You'll also need a key decoder that provides measurements for Kwikset, Weslock, Schlage master keys and Schlage. You'll also require a lockpick set and an instrument with a long reach in order to unlock cars. These tools are designed to be used to manipulate the pins in the lock cylinder to allow you to unlock the door without breaking the lock.

There are a variety of key cutting machines. Each one is designed to work with a specific kind of lock. Manual key cutters require the user to manually move keys through the tracing wheels and cutter wheels. This is perfect for those who are just starting out or who only require cutting one or two keys at a time. The JMA Nomad and Silca Flash are good choices for a manual key cutter.

A key machine that is automatic does all the work for you. However it's more expensive than a manual model. The Silca 040 is the top automated machine available today.

A vice is a different essential tool. It is used to hold the key in place while it is being made. A large vise is ideal for a car, while smaller ones are adequate for vans. A sturdy, high-quality vise will last a long time and will help keep the key in place while filing.

Other tools you might consider for your toolbox include a padlock shim that is used to break up padlocks by placing the thin metal piece around the shackle. You'll also require locks with picks and a tubular pick, Car Keys Cut which are used to move the pins in the key hole of locks. These tools are especially useful for picking locks which are difficult to open with the standard key.

A key extractor for broken keys allows you to remove a piece of a broken key that is stuck in the keyhole. This is a great tool to have, and it is available in some basic kit for opening cars or buy it separately.

Safety

Car key cutting is more than shaping a piece of metal, it's an art that provides security, ease of use, and peace of mind for the owner. This process requires special equipment and Car Keys Cut software. It should be carried out by a reputable locksmith or car dealership. A key cut incorrectly could damage the lock and cause extra costs for repair or replacement. A badly cut key can cause problems in the future because it may not fit properly.

When you are deciding on a professional to cut your spare car key it is essential to select one that utilizes a high-quality blade that ensures the correct positioning of the chip. Blades that are less expensive can result in less-than-quality cuts that can cause the key to wear out more quickly and could break inside the lock. It is also crucial to make sure the key is made from the correct kind of metal. Some online sites sell sidewinder chips of poor quality, which could harm the machine that cuts keys or cause your keys to malfunction.

If your vehicle has a transponder or smart key, it will have to be programmed after the cutting process. These keys are encrypted to ensure that only the right key can be used to start the vehicle. If you are using an online service that duplicates keys at home, you may be unable to program the key correctly.

It is recommended that you have an additional car key for these types of vehicles, so you do not lose the original key or put it in the car.
